About M. Flynn Jewelry

M Flynn has been changing the jewelry landscape in Boston for over 15 years. We design engagement rings and fine jewelry in-house while curating collections from some of the industry's most sought-after designers, including Anita Ko, Brent Neale, Kwiat, Melissa Kaye, Marla Aaron.

We're a small, collaborative team that loves beautiful jewelry, exceptional customer service, and creating memorable experiences for our clients. We are looking for a Sales & Service Coordinator, who is organized, proactive, and enjoys being the person who keeps everything running smoothy. This is our behind-the-scenes engine that supports our sales team and ensures an exceptional client experience. This role is responsible for online order fulfillment, shipping and receiving, inventory movement, repair coordination, and operational support so our sales associates can focus on building client relationships and selling.This is an on-site position based at our 40 Waltham St., Boston location, and the work week is Tuesday – Saturday.

 

Primary Responsibilities

Sales Support

  • Supports the sales team with day-to-day operational needs.
  • Assist with customer inquiries regarding online orders, shipping, repairs, exchanges, and pickups.
  • Helps create a consistently warm, welcoming experience for every client - in store, phone or email.

Online Orders & Fulfillment

  • Process and fulfill all online orders accurately and efficiently.
  • Package every shipment to reflect Flynn's luxury client experience.
  • Coordinate shipping, tracking, insurance, and delivery confirmations.

Operations Support & Vendor Coordination

  • Receive incoming merchandise from designers and vendors.
  • Process & tag new inventory into our systems.
  • Coordinate inventory transfers and keep track of RTVs for accounting

Repairs & Customer Communication

  • Coordinate repair intake and customer pickups.
  • Help sales communicate repair updates and timelines to clients.
  • Track repairs from intake through completion.

General Store Support

  • Help set up store in mornings and in evenings.
  • Maintain an organized back-of-house workspace.
  • Assist with gift wrapping and client presentation.

About You:  You are someone who loves creating order, enjoys solving problems, and finds satisfaction in making sure every detail is handled beautifully. You enjoy working closely with every department in the company and play a key role in supporting our clients, our sales team, and the overall success of our business. You possess exceptional organizational skills and attention to detail, clear written and verbal communication skills, a friendly, positive, and professional and customer-focused demeanor, skills in multitasking in a fast-paced retail environment and demonstrated self-motivation and ability to prioritize independently. Prior luxury retail, jewelry, fashion, or hospitality experience is preferred. Ability to lift and move shipping boxes and inventory as needed is required.

Our ideal candidate loves organization, enjoys checking things off a list, communicates clearly both verbally and in writing, and takes pride in making sure no detail is overlooked.
